Tile’s inception in 2012 marked a swift rise, reaching 2 million units sold within two years. The founders, Mike Farley and Nick Evans, navigated challenges, including unexpected demand and manufacturing delays. The Bluetooth 4.0 technology’s ubiquity transformed Tile’s trajectory, while strategic partnerships, like teaming up with Jabil, addressed manufacturing challenges.
